Staxxx preaches positivity through music
13 Mar 2017
Kago Serole, famously known as ‘Staxxx’ in the entertainment scenes, believes music has the power to heal and inspire broken souls.
The young lad who started singing aged nine has not only been touching many people’s lives with his music, but also motivated them to follow their dreams like he did.
“There is so much power in music because it has the ability to impact so many people’s lives in such an amazing way. I always get humbled when people tell me that they relate so much with my music,” he said.
He said when he started making music, he wanted to share the story of his life with others as he realised that by sharing his highs and lows he would in turn touch others who might be going through the same challenge.
He added that as a hip hop artist, he has mastered the art of attracting all ages as he writes music for the masses.
He added that he preaches prosperity, positivity and the beauty of life in his songs. “I choose to sing as I wanted to communicate with humanity through song. Everybody loves a good song and the message gets easily sent because when you lay down your feelings in a song, many can relate with it and look forward to the future,” he said.
Serole thus far has incredible three albums to his name and has performed at some of the top music festivals, these include The sky Girls BW express yourself tour, Sky fest, The major legue Lit sessions with Ambitious Entertainment from South Africa just to name a few.
He explained that the reception he has received for the albums has been phenomenal as Batswana are always looking forward to his next songs. “Batswana have been so supportive and they always give me positive response regarding my albums, they love the albums,” he said.
He further added that catering for his fans has been one of his most principal as it is through them that he is now on his way to be counted among the best.
“One of my songs called ‘Regardless’ talks about overcoming obstacles with so much positivity, this is one of the songs that has been getting a lot of airplay and many love it because it comforts a lot of broken hearts out there,” he said.
With all his hard work and determination, it was only fair that Serole get chosen to be the ambassador of an organisation called ‘Young Love’ which is a youth campaign against intergeneration sex.
“It is such a privilege to be the face of such an amazing organisation that helps the youth to focus on great things that will be good for their future as opposed to the bad that will damage their future,” he said.
Although all artists have people they aspire to be like, Serole on the other hand believes he is his own role model as everyday for him, it’s a new day to perfect yesterday’s mistakes.
He said he aspires to inspire other young people who want to make it in the music industry and be their role model as his story is from humble beginnings.
“I started from nothing to be where I am today, I hope this can inspire young ones to take their craft seriously and nurture it so that it grows to be a success story,” he said.
The former television presenter further explained that he however recognises other giants in the hip hop scenes like the likes of SCAR, Zues, AKA, Kanye West and Drake because these are artists he grew up listening to.
“I love how they always release amazing albums, their business skills are really amazing and I learn a lot from them each day I listen to their music,” he added.
The 22-year-old is destined for greatness and he says he is only starting as the future looks bright for him.
“I am glad I started perfecting and polishing my talent at a young age because this has allowed me to grow musically and offer people the best of the best, I believe people mature with age and my maturity can be seen in my music,” he said. ENDS
